Organisational Relations

Written by: Maya, the Great Mother
Date: Wednesday, April 15th, 2009
Addressed to: Everyone


Last month, we announced that adventurer organisations could now ally
with denizen organisations. Previously, only cities, divine Orders, and
the Church could do so. Now, the full gamut of organisations may declare
org relations - with other adventurer organisations as well as denizen
organisations: cities, Houses, Divine Orders, the Church, Oakstone, and
some clans.

I've updated some syntax to reflect the changes and make it easier to
view which orgs are hostile or allied to each other. CITY RELATIONS
still works as before (though mutually neutral relations are no longer
shown), but CITY RELATIONS <HOSTILE|NEUTRAL> has been superceded by ORG
RELATIONS <HOSTILE|NEUTRAL>. Org relations are a matter of public
record, which means you can view the org relations of any organisation
that is able to set such relations: you can do CITY RELATIONS SHALLAM,
for example, even if you are not a citizen of Shallam.

A couple points of note:
- As with cities, if two adventurer organisations are mutually hostile
to each other, they are AT WAR. For cities, that means city soldiers of
the cities at war are free PK to each other. For all other orgs, it
means that ALL members of the organisations are free PK to each other.
Use wisely.
- Clans may not set relations without special permission from the
Garden. OOC, private, or secret clans will not receive this permission.

For further details, see HELP ORG RELATIONS.
